Action item: The Relayn deploy-status bot silently dropped updates when the pipeline API paginated results, so responders believed a rollback had completed when it had not. We will add pagination handling, a staleness banner, and an integration test. Until merged, verify deploy state directly in the pipeline console, documented at the page below.

runbook for kahop-kajop: https://rundeck.ordinio.test/display/secrets/pipeline/issue/pages/repo/browse/e5732776e07d1285107e5aeb

Quick board briefing on the Veltmere region sales review. Short version: Q3 came in ahead of plan, mostly thanks to the Corvale distributor push, while the Ashbrook territory lagged again. Marta Quill's team is reworking coverage there before year-end. Full numbers in the appendix. One sensitive item on next year's plans follows below.

board note of fahif-yahog: Gross margin on Wenath came in at 10 percent against a plan of 5 percent. Only 3 of the 100 pilot accounts renewed Wenath, so a churn review is set for July 15.

Handover — orders soft deletes

To the release manager: handing this to Priya. Soft deletes on the orders table in Cartwheel shipped behind a flag last sprint. Deleted rows keep a tombstone timestamp; the purge job hard-deletes after the retention window. Do not ship the purge job before the flag hits 100%. Rollback is flag-off only; no schema revert needed. Current service configuration for the cut:

config for yajep-tafof:
[rusath]
team = julmir
access_code = ac_fe37fd
host = rusath.novactech.test
port = 8000
owner = pelmir.weneth
peer = oliwyn.olvarqdyn.internal

## 2.4.0 — Changed defaults

CatalogueBridge now imports MARC batches with strict deduplication on by default. Previously duplicates were flagged but retained; the Holloway Public Library pilot showed this doubled shelf-ready records. Batch size default dropped from 5000 to 1000 to keep the Pellford ingest nodes under memory limits. Retry-on-malformed-record is now off; bad rows go straight to the reject queue. Release managers should confirm downstream consumers before tagging. The new defaults shipped to staging are as follows.

deployment values, tafog-kagap:
wenath:
  pin: 4244
  metrics_host: metrics.wenath.lumicsys.internal
  tenant: istix
  seal: seal_10585894